#90c153 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#90c153 is composed of 56.5% red, 75.7%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 57%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 86.7 degrees, a saturation of 47% and a lightness of 54.1%. #90c153 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a6 with #218300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

● #90c153 color description : Moderate green.
The hexadecimal color #90c153 has RGB values of R:144, G:193,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 9486675.
